    Viasat Unveils HaloNet Capability Portfolio for Near-Earth Communications and Beyond

    CARLSBAD, Calif., Aug. 11,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Viasat, Inc. (NASDAQ:VSAT), a global leader in satellite communications, today unveiled its HaloNet™ portfolio, a modular set of capabilities with a next-generation connectivity architecture that unifies space and terrestrial connectivity into a cohesive service offering. Developed across global teams within Viasat Government and the Defense and Advanced Technologies segment, HaloNet is designed to transform near-Earth communications with flexible, multi-orbit network and data services that can be tailored to a customer's specific mission requirements.

    Today's emerging government and commercial low Earth orbit (LEO) operators require an agile, reliable, and secure communications infrastructure that can quickly and cost-effectively transport data. These rapidly growing LEO operations need the ability to effectively transport mission data back to earth for analysis and distribution while balancing real-time demands and data latency, as well as maintain continuous contact with the spacecraft for command and control.

    HaloNet is designed to provide simultaneous connectivity to thousands of space vehicles (SV) across the full range of orbital inclinations, including polar and retrograde orbits, at any latitude. HaloNet services can serve missions at altitudes in LEO up to 1100 km, as well as missions in medium Earth orbit. Viasat's diverse portfolio offers a comprehensive, turnkey launch and orbital communications solution for emerging industry needs, providing multi-band GEO-relay and Direct-to-Earth (DTE) satellite communications services for a wide range of mission needs.

    HaloNet combines the best of the company's space and ground capabilities to deliver a unified approach to command, control, and data dissemination. These capabilities include:

    • Telemetry, Tracking, and Command (TT&C) Data Relay Service (DRS): Provides real-time situational awareness and connectivity with spacecraft through secure, low-latency links via Viasat's L-band network, giving satellite operators access to the satellite and data they need, when they need it.
    • Launch Telemetry DRS: Offers real-time telemetry data relay during the launch phase through Viasat's L-band network without the need to build or lease dedicated downrange ground stations. This service will offer launch providers reliable connectivity from ignition to orbit.
    • High-Capacity DRS: Will enable transmission of large volumes of data (e.g., full-motion video, high-res imagery, etc.) on demand, without prescheduling through Viasat's Ka-band network. Global coverage promotes continuous access wherever a customer's spacecraft travels.
    • Direct-to-Earth (DTE) Service: Provides direct-to-Earth data services through Viasat's Ground Station as a Service (GSaaS) platform, delivering high performance TT&C and payload downlinks via a global ground station network spanning six continents.
    • Mobile Command & Control: Offers a field-deployable command and control platform via a self-contained mobile satellite gateway. This mobile ground platform solution is designed to support secure TT&C data transport from virtually any location.

    Based on mission parameters, HaloNet will use GEO relay satellites to dynamically deliver data. The relay transport paths will be L-band, Ka-band or optical links with expected data rates ranging from 10's of Kbps to more than 10 Gbps for secure data dissemination on demand or pre-scheduled. Viasat's global DTE ground antennas provide increased optionality and further resilience. HaloNet's portfolio will provide a comprehensive solution for government and commercial users to access diverse data transport options that can be leveraged for different mission requirements.

    About Viasat

    Viasat is a global communications company that believes everyone and everything in the world can be connected. With offices in 24 countries around the world, our mission shapes how consumers, businesses, governments and militaries around the world communicate and connect. Viasat is developing the ultimate global communications network to power high-quality, reliable, secure, affordable, fast connections to positively impact people's lives anywhere they are—on the ground, in the air or at sea, while building a sustainable future in space. In May 2023, Viasat completed its acquisition of Inmarsat, combining the teams, technologies and resources of the two companies to create a new global communications partner.
